
The Hidden Connections Between Mood, Time, and Mental Health
Recent findings from a study analyzing nearly 1 million observations reveal fascinating insights into the intricate links between our daily rhythms, mood fluctuations, and overall mental health. This extensive research sheds light on how our perception of time can considerably influence our emotional and psychological well-being.

Practical Tips for Enhancing Your Mood Through Routine
According to the findings, crafting a consistent daily routine can profoundly impact mood. Simple habits like regular meal times, exercise, and even work schedules can create a framework that fosters emotional stability. Integrating practices like mindfulness and self-care into our routines can elevate our sense of wellness and reduce the risk of mental health challenges.
